I just took off my 70-200 mm lens. And Oh Dear… what did I almost miss?
All the screws holding the base on were loose, ready to fall out. All four of them!
Solution is simple: a screwdriver.
Disaster averted. It was ready to fall off!
I recommend you all feel your lenses for looseness at the base, and if they are a little loose, check the screws. In fact – check the screws anyway. Especially on the 70-200, but I shall now go check all my 7 lenses.
